Kinds of Welder’s Certifications
Although the AWS’ basic Certified Welder certificate paves the way for most work opportunities, a number of industries will require their certain certification. Several of the most-common of them appear below.
- CWI and SCWI Certification for inspectors and senior inspectors
- American Petroleum Institute Certification for welders that work on pipelines in the gas and oil field
- Certified Welder Credentials to be a Certified Welder
- American Society of Mechanical Engineers Certification for individuals who focus on boiler and pressure vessels

Job and Salary
Welder Positions in Pleasure Bend, LA
As reported by the O*Net Online, welding specialists are very much in demand in the State of Louisiana. Having an expected average increase in new welder jobs to grow particularly fast each year through 2022, the fantastic rate of growth is much above the national average for all jobs. As you can tell, becoming a welder in Pleasure Bend, LA may be easier than you would imagine – particularly when compared with other jobs.
The table illustrates jobs and earnings projections for professional welders in Louisiana through 2022.
| Louisiana | Employment |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 2022 | Change | Annual Job Openings |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ers | 14,590 | 16,640 | 14% | 650 |
| Louisiana | Annual Salary |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| Median | High |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ers |
$29,800 | $42,000 | $59,200 |
Source: O*Net Online
Welding Training – The Things to Expect
Deciding which school to sign-up for is generally an individual matter, but here are several things that you ought to know about prior to deciding on welding schools. The first thing in getting started in a position as a welder is to decide which of the top welding courses will be right for you. To begin with, you must be sure the training program is currently authorized by the American Welding Society. A few other items that you’ll want to focus on aside from the accreditation status include:
- Attempt to find schools that satisfy AWS SENSE standards
- Be sure the program teaches on equipment that satisfies field standards
- Determine if the facility supplies financial assistance
- Make certain that the college’s curriculum provides courses in SMAW, GMAW, GTAW and pipe welding
